Ferguson Police Department

The Ferguson Police Department is based in Ferguson, Missouri, and gained national attention following the shooting of Michael Brown, an unarmed Black teenager, by a police officer in 2014. This incident sparked protests and highlighted issues of racial inequality and police practices in the U.S. A subsequent Department of Justice investigation revealed systemic problems within the department, including racial bias and excessive use of force. The events in Ferguson prompted a broader dialogue about policing, community relations, and the need for reform across law enforcement agencies in America.
